You will not be disappointed, and I'd be shocked if the first words out of your mouth when using this stuff weren't 'OH YUK!'" —Kimmy D Each kit comes with enough clear film to insulate 10 standard windows. To apply it, you first attach the included double-sided tape to your window frame, measure your window and cut the film to size, press it onto the tape, and then shrink it with a blow-dryer so it adheres to your window. Some reviewers say they improved the process by working out bubbles with a credit card as they went. Promising review: "This product kept my apartment warm and toasty last winter!
